eolymp
bolt
Попробуйте наш новый интерфейс для отправки задач
Задачи

Кодирование

Кодирование

Последовательность битов кодируется следующим образом. Если значение предыдущего бита исходной последовательности отличается от значения текущего кодируемого бита, в результирующую последовательность записывается 1. Если значения битов не отличаются, то записывается 0. Для первого бита последовательности предыдущим является бит со значением 0.

Напишите программу, выполняющую кодирование.

Входные данные

Строка длиной не более 100 символов, состоящая только из 0 и 1, представляющая собой кодируемую последовательность битов.

Выходные данные

Вывести результат кодирования.

Лимит времени 1 секунда
Лимит использования памяти 128 MiB
Входные данные #1
10010111
Выходные данные #1
11011100